If a pulse is not identified within 10 seconds, immediately begin administering CPR, starting with chest compressions. Compressions should occur at a rate of 100 to 120 compressions per minute, with a depth of 2 inches. Use a compression-to-ventilation ratio of 30 compressions to 2 breaths. WebCPR stands for cardiopulmonary resuscitation. It is a lifesaving procedure that is done when a child's breathing or heartbeat has stopped. This may happen after drowning, suffocation, choking, or an injury. CPR involves: Rescue breathing, which provides oxygen to a child's lungs. WebAug 1, 2016 · Finally, together with the studies showing rapid deterioration of the myocardium in even a few seconds without CPR after a cardiac arrest, it gives the important message that periods without CPR (for ECG analysis, defibrillation charging, pulse checks, intubation attempts, etc) should be kept to a minimum. Agonal breathing is not compatible with life. It's a sign of imminent cardiac arrest. A proper pulse check is the most poorly performed task rescuers perform. Even healthcare providers regularly fail to properly perform a pulse check. Adequate breathing is a sign of life.

WebROSC (or the return of spontaneous circulation) is the resumption of sustained perfusing cardiac activity associated with significant respiratory effort after cardiac arrest.
